    Abstract: A housing for modularizing a heat pump system of a clothes dryer and a clothes dryer having the same are disclosed. The heat pump system modularized housing of the clothes collectively modularizes a condenser, a compressor, an evaporator and an expansion valve that constitute the heat pump system of the clothes dryer. Not only does the heat pump system is stably mounted in the clothes dryer but also components of the heat pump system can be effectively protected. In addition, the fastening procedures of each component can be unified to simplify an assembling process of the clothes dryer, and thus, the productivity can be improved. Moreover, a structure of an internal flow path of the clothes dryer can be simplified to thus improve efficiency of the heat pump system.

    Abstract: A clothes dryer includes a cabinet, a drum rotatably installed within the cabinet and a heating unit that heats the drum. Because the heating unit heats the drum itself, heat generated from the heating unit is transferred to the outer surface of the drum, passes through the interior of the drum according to thermal conduction and then heats the clothes, target items to be dried, so that temperature of the entire clothes are uniformly increased to accelerate evaporation of moisture of the target items to be dried.

    Abstract: Disclosed in a control method of a clothes dryer. The drying method of a clothes dryer, includes: detecting a temperature of the air exhausted from a drum; determining a change in water content of a drying material on the basis of the detected temperature; and controlling a drying operation according to the water content change of the drying material. Accordingly, the air temperature in an exhaust port of a drum is measured, and a water content or a temperature of a drying material can be determined on the basis of data about a gradient of the temperature change.
